As  the  nation  celebrates Saif  and  Kareena’s  second child ,my mind goes back to  the  time when Kareena , much younger  far more impulsive told me she told me  she  would never get married. As for children, are you joking?!

As with much of what she would say  during those days of impulsive youth I’d  just smile at her  headstrong  declarations knowing she would change her mind sooner rather than later.

From saying  no to Kaho Na…Pyar Hai to  saying  yes and then no  to  Devdas to  saying no to Bajirao Mastani….Kareena was always impulsive and also  very moody. In fact she warned me about her moods when I  got to know her. “You  better get used to it.”

 When  Kareena started her career with my dear friend J P Dutta’s Refugee she didn’t want to be the glamour queen at all.

“Looking hot and sexy is  my sister’s domain. I am a very  simple girl at heart. I love my salwar and kameez and  I want to spend my life in them(the salwaar and  kameez). I want to  play real women. My role models  are  Madhubala, Nutan and Waheeda Rehman. I want to  do the kind of roles they did,” she  told me in her first  interview  .

A few weeks later she  called nervously to say she had just signed  a film with Abbas-Mastan  where she had  to be  the archetypal glam diva, “Chiffon sarees, backless blouses. I don’t know how I can carry them off.”

I told her she would be  just fine. And she was. She wanted to play Nutan’s role Kalyani  in Bandini. When  my friend Deepa Mehta  offered  her  the widow Kalyani’s role in Water through me,  she  jumped at it and then  chickened  out saying she was too inexperienced for something so complex.

I don’t know how  she is  now. But back then Kareena(never ‘Bebo’ for me,thank you) flourished in extremities. She either  ‘hated’ or ‘loved’  her colleagues. The  female  co-stars  were specially  annoying to her.One of them who is today  a global star complained to me about Kareena’s behavior during a concert abroad.  Kareena  couldn’t help laughing over how  ‘tacky’ this particular actress  was. Her blood  would boil when I  wrote  praises for another actress. Sometimes she would actually call and read out what I had written about others to embarrass me.

 I was supposed to  praise only Kareena. Yes, she  is  very possessive about the people  close to her.She got along  very well with her male  co-stars,Salman being a favourite with both the sisters. But her favourites kept changing. Karan  Johar  who she once told me  was  the only male  allowed into her home where  she lived with her mom(I had to wait for her in the car when I visited)  at one point became  hostile  territory.

When she  was seeing someone long ago she couldn’t stop raving about his mother.The  next thing I knew I was being told that the mother did kala jadoo on her to get rid of her.

This is  not the Kareena that we all see today.  After Saif, she changed drastically became  far less impetuous and far  more family-oriented. Most important of all she learnt to be gregarious and  social. She at one point hated  the social media and  didn’t even have en email ID(yes, believe  it or not!). Today she is all over posting pictures, hosting talk shows, etc.

Kareena is constantly evolving.From salwar kameez to gowns,  from Refugee to Ajnabee  , from  footloose to  Saif. From never-want-to-be-a-mother to how-could-I-live-without-Taimur. Now  from mother of one to the  mother of two.Keep changing.It suits  you.
